I used a set of footpegs from a 1983 Honda CX650 turbo on my KZ1000 project. I found them at a local salvage yard, glass beaded them and ordered new rubber treds for them. I think all I needed to do to mount them was trim a small amount from one surface so that they were level when mounted.
